Mark ZuckerbergPick up your Prada from the cleaners, slip on your flip flops and get wired in — because a Social Network sequel is reportedly on its way. Deadline reported on Wednesday, June 25, that after years of searching for an angle to expand his 2010 film, Aaron Sorkin will write and direct The Social Network II for Sony Pictures.
